One of the first steps to recognize a secure online environment is checking the website’s URL. A trustworthy website usually starts with “https://” rather than just “http://.” The extra “s” stands for secure, indicating that the website uses encryption to protect your data. Additionally, many secure sites display a padlock symbol in the browser’s address bar. Clicking on this padlock provides details about the website’s security certificate, which shows that the site has been verified and is safe to use. Users should always avoid websites that lack these security features, especially if they involve financial transactions or sensitive personal information.

Another important approach is to look at the website’s reputation. Trusted websites often have reviews or mentions on reputable platforms. You can check for user feedback, ratings, or articles that discuss the site’s reliability. If multiple users report problems or suspicious behavior, it is a sign to stay away. Similarly, official websites of businesses or services usually have clear contact information and transparent policies regarding privacy and security. Avoid websites that hide contact details or have unclear ownership, as these are common red flags for phishing and fraudulent sites.

Links shared through emails, social media, or messaging apps should also be treated with caution. Cybercriminals often use fake links to trick users into entering personal information. To verify a link’s safety, hover over it before clicking to see the full URL. If the address looks strange or contains misspellings, it is better not to click. Another useful tool is using online link scanners, which check if a URL is associated with malware or phishing attempts. These simple steps can significantly reduce the risk of visiting harmful websites.

Recognizing secure online environments also involves understanding website design and content. Trusted websites typically maintain professional layouts, functional pages, and updated information. Poor design, broken links, or constant pop-ups can indicate an unsafe website. Additionally, authentic websites provide clear terms of service and privacy policies. These documents explain how user data is collected, stored, and used, helping visitors determine whether the site values their privacy. Websites lacking this information should be approached with caution.

Social proof and verification badges also help identify trustworthy websites. Many online platforms, especially e-commerce or social media sites, display verified badges or certifications from recognized authorities. These badges indicate that the platform meets specific standards of security and credibility. While these marks can be helpful, users should remember that fake badges exist. Therefore, cross-checking the website through official channels is always a good idea.

Regularly updating your browser, antivirus software, and operating system is another way to ensure online safety. Secure websites are only one part of the equation; having updated security tools protects your devices from vulnerabilities. Modern browsers often include features that warn users about suspicious websites, and antivirus programs can block harmful downloads. Combining safe browsing habits with technology updates creates a strong defense against online threats.
